Scott Family Amazeum The Scott Family Amazeum is a fantastic children’s museum in Bentonville, Arkansas. The museum was opened in July 2015 with the support of the Lee Scott family, the Walmart Foundation, and other contributors. The museum is the best place for children to discover new things related to science, technology, arts, engineering, and math. The museum is inspired by the landscape, culture, history, and contains about 50,000 square feet of hands-on, learning activities for the entire family.
You can visit this museum with the entire family and can spend a day exploring science, technology, engineering, arts, and math through a play at the museum. There is extensive outdoor space for play. It is an interactive museum. Local people and people from the adjoining regions visit the museum to learn new things from the exhibits which also encourage them to solve problems and have fun in different ways. The museum also has a big checker square and a chalk wall. There is a wide range of activities for your child to take part in and enjoy the sunshine in the outdoor space of the museum.
The museum also hosts virtual home school days. Children can create something exciting and different as some examples of virtual home school days include ice balloons and chromatography. It helps children to learn about force and motion through practical things. Sanitized baskets are available that contain everything your child will require to explore and discover new things out of curiosity.
You have to pay $10 per child or adult but the museum also hosts a priceless night from 4-7:30 PM on Wednesdays. During this day and time, you can pay as you wish. The museum also offers membership programs that start from $105 as a basic membership fee for a family of 4 up to $1000 for premier membership for a family of six people. Children up to the age of 2 are admitted for free. Avoid visiting the museum on Tuesday and public holidays as it is closed on these days.
